国产日韩AV在线播放,熟女人妇交换俱乐部,无码人妻一区二区三区在线视频,www国产亚洲精品

網(wǎng)站運營 yunwei

當前位置:首頁 > 文檔 > 網(wǎng)站運營

軟件搭建過程中服務器不兼容怎么處理?

時間:2025-06-18 已閱:60 次

在軟件搭建過程中遇到服務器不兼容問題,需從硬件、軟件環(huán)境、配置等多維度分析原因并針對性解決,系統(tǒng)化的處理流程和解決方案:

一、診斷服務器不兼容的具體原因

1. 硬件層面不兼容服務器CPU內(nèi)存、存儲等硬件無法滿足軟件最低配置要求,或硬件驅動與軟件沖突,如顯卡驅動不支持虛擬化技術,排查方法對比軟件官方文檔中的硬件要求,如CPU指令集內(nèi)存容量磁盤IOPS等,使用硬件檢測工具如Windows的系統(tǒng)信息,Linux的lshw命令查看服務器硬件參數(shù)。

2. 操作系統(tǒng)軟件環(huán)境不兼容,軟件不支持當前服務器操作系統(tǒng),僅支持Linux卻安裝在Windows上,或依賴的運行環(huán)境缺失,如缺少版本不匹配,排查檢查軟件安裝包的,系統(tǒng)兼容性說明運行環(huán)境檢測查看版本。

3. 配置參數(shù)沖突服務器防火墻、安全策略或端口配置限制軟件運行,如80端口被占用或內(nèi)核參數(shù),如文件句柄數(shù)未優(yōu)化,查看軟件啟動日志通常在/var/log或軟件安裝目錄下,定位報錯關鍵詞檢查防火墻規(guī)則,如Linux的iptables -L和端口占用netstat -tunlp。

4. 網(wǎng)絡或云服務兼容性問題云服務器的虛擬化平臺,如AWS EC2、阿里云 ECS與軟件的虛擬化依賴不兼容,或網(wǎng)絡帶寬延遲導致服務異常,查看云服務商文檔中關于軟件兼容性的說明Docker在特定云平臺的適配問題,通過ping、traceroute測試網(wǎng)絡連通性,使用speedtest檢測帶寬。

5. 硬件不兼容的處理升級硬件,若CPU不支持指令集如VT-x虛擬化技術,更換支持的CPU或調(diào)整軟件架構如放棄虛擬化部署,內(nèi)存不足時增加內(nèi)存條,存儲IO瓶頸可更換SSD或配置RAID,硬件替代若物理服務器升級成本高,可遷移至云服務器如AWS、阿里云,按需選擇硬件配置如計算型、內(nèi)存型實例。

6. 操作系統(tǒng)環(huán)境兼容適配系統(tǒng)版本,軟件僅支持Ubuntu 22.04而服務器當前為CentOS 8,可重新安裝系統(tǒng)或使用容器化部署,如Docker如在Windows服務器運行Linux軟件時,可通過WSL、Windows Subsystem for Linux、模擬環(huán)境,修復運行環(huán)境缺失依賴時,通過包管理器安裝版本不兼容時,降級升級軟件、如 Python3.8 不兼容,切換至Python 3.9或使用版本管理器pyenv。

7. 配置沖突調(diào)整服務器配置,防火墻放行端口優(yōu)化內(nèi)核參數(shù),修改增加文件句柄限制并執(zhí)行sysctl -p生效,避免端口沖突更換軟件監(jiān)聽端口,如將80端口改為8080,修改配置文件。

8. 云服務與網(wǎng)絡問題處理云平臺適配,如Docker在阿里云ECS上運行異常,可參考阿里云文檔安裝適配版Docker如使用yum install aliyun-docker,啟用云服務商的兼容組件,AWS的EC2 Instance Connect 解決SSH連接問題,網(wǎng)絡優(yōu)化若公網(wǎng)帶寬不足,升級云服務器帶寬或使用CDN 加速靜態(tài)資源內(nèi)網(wǎng)環(huán)境中,確保服務器與其他組件,數(shù)據(jù)庫、緩存的網(wǎng)絡互通檢查IP白名單、VPC 配置。

9. 替代方案與預防措施臨時替代,容器化部署通過Docker/Kubernetes將軟件封裝在容器中,屏蔽服務器底層環(huán)境差異,需服務器支持容器引擎,虛擬化使用 VMware、VirtualBox創(chuàng)建虛擬機,在虛擬機中部署兼容的操作系統(tǒng)適用于測試環(huán)境,預防兼容性問題搭建前檢測,使用兼容性檢測工具掃描服務器環(huán)境,在測試服務器上先進行小規(guī)模部署,驗證兼容性后再上線。

10.總結步驟定位問題通過日志、檢測工具確定不兼容的具體環(huán)節(jié)、硬件 、系統(tǒng) 、配置、匹配需求對比軟件官方要求,確認服務器缺失的組件或參數(shù),執(zhí)行方案按優(yōu)先級升級硬件、調(diào)整環(huán)境或配置,必要時采用容器虛擬化,驗證效果重啟服務后觀察運行狀態(tài),使用壓力測試工具(如 JMeter)驗證穩(wěn)定性。

關聯(lián)標簽:
訪問控制技術中的零信任架構是如何實現(xiàn)的?

需要明確零信任架構的核心原則,確?;卮饻蚀_零信任的核心是默認不信任,始終驗證不管用戶是在內(nèi)部還是外部,都需要經(jīng)過嚴格的身份驗證和權限控制,要分步驟解釋實現(xiàn)方法,可能包括身份認證、權限管理、動態(tài)訪問控制、微隔離等方面。用戶......

制定系統(tǒng)開發(fā)需求變更管理計劃需從流程設計角色評估

制定系統(tǒng)開發(fā)需求變更管理計劃需從流程設計角色評估一、計劃核心組成部分與框架計劃目標與原則將需求變更導致的項目延期控制在內(nèi),使的變更在內(nèi)完成評估,核心原則所有變更可追溯,變更記錄留存至項目結束,業(yè)務價值優(yōu)變更原則上拒絕,技......

軟件制定成本控制策略時如何平衡短期成本與長期效益

在制定軟件開發(fā)后續(xù)升級的成本控制策略時,平衡短期成本與長期效益需要從需求分析、技術選型、資源分配等多維度切入,避免因過度壓縮短期成本而導致長期技術債務累積。一、建立成本效益量化評估模型,短期成本與長期效益的量化維度,核心......

軟件開發(fā)的后續(xù)升級是保障系統(tǒng)持續(xù)滿足業(yè)務需求

軟件開發(fā)的后續(xù)升級是保障系統(tǒng)持續(xù)滿足業(yè)務需求一、軟件開發(fā)后續(xù)升級的主要類型功能迭代升級目的根據(jù)用戶反饋、市場需求或業(yè)務拓展,增加新功能、優(yōu)化現(xiàn)有功能、用戶需求變化、競品功能迭代、業(yè)務模式調(diào)整,技術架構升級提升系統(tǒng)性能、穩(wěn)......

APP純開發(fā)的周期一般是多長可以正式上線運營?

純開發(fā)APP的周期通常在70到180天左右,具體時長受應用復雜性、功能需求、開發(fā)團隊經(jīng)驗等因素影響,以下是不同類型 APP的大致開發(fā)周期分析:簡單APP:如基本的商城或生活服務類APP,功能相對單一主要包括商品展示、簡單的用戶......

APP定制原生開發(fā)跨平臺開發(fā)等多種模式以及技術選型

APP定制原生開發(fā)跨平臺開發(fā)等多種模式以及技術選型開發(fā)方式:原生開發(fā):使用特定平臺的編程語言如iOS平臺用,其優(yōu)勢是能充分利用設備硬件資源,性能佳可完全訪問設備功能,用戶體驗好,但缺點是需為每個平臺分別開發(fā)維護代碼庫,開發(fā)......

域名一直不收錄什么原因?新站加速收錄技巧

域名不收錄通常指的是搜索引擎沒有將網(wǎng)站的內(nèi)容編入索引,導致用戶在搜索時找不到該網(wǎng)站,這可能涉及多個方面,比如搜索引擎的抓取問題、網(wǎng)站本身的結構問題,或者內(nèi)容質量的問題。可能的原因有哪些呢?比如域名是否被懲罰過,網(wǎng)站是否有......

企業(yè)如何購買適合自己的服務器硬件選型成本以及兼容性

企業(yè)購買服務器通常需要考慮業(yè)務類型、規(guī)模、預算、擴展性、運維能力等等,用戶可能希望得到一個系統(tǒng)的購買指南,涵蓋需求分析、選型要點、供應商選擇、成本控制等方面。應該從需求分析入手,幫助用戶明確自己的業(yè)務需求,比如是用于網(wǎng)站......

比較容器化和云服務在解決服務器不兼容問題上的成本

成本包括初期投入運維成本、資源使用成本技術團隊成本、時間成本以及潛在的隱性成本,需要分別分析容器化和云服務在這些方面的表現(xiàn)。初期投入可能包括學習Docker或Kubernetes的成本,購買或配置容器管理工具,以及可能的硬件升級以支持......

軟件搭建過程中服務器不兼容怎么處理?

在軟件搭建過程中遇到服務器不兼容問題,需從硬件、軟件環(huán)境、配置等多維度分析原因并針對性解決,系統(tǒng)化的處理流程和解決方案:一、診斷服務器不兼容的具體原因1. 硬件層面不兼容服務器CPU內(nèi)存、存儲等硬件無法滿足軟件最低配置要求,......